1. Understanding French Doors

French doors usually include 2 hinged doors that open outwards or inwards. Their design permits for optimum light direct exposure while maintaining an elegant appearance. Generally made from wood or fiberglass and featuring several glass panes, these doors reflect elegance however can be vulnerable to various issues in time.

2. Common French Door Issues

Despite their toughness, French doors can establish a number of issues. Some common issues include:

Table 2: Common Issues with French Doors

Concern

Description

Misalignment

Doors do not close appropriately, causing spaces

Drafts

Air leakage due to improper sealing

Broken or fogged glass

Damage to glass panes can decrease effectiveness

Harmed hinges

Rusted or broken hinges can prevent door function

Decomposing frames

Wood frames might rot due to moisture direct exposure

Weather condition removing failure

Used weather removing can result in drafts and sound

4. The Repair Process

When professional repair services are engaged, house owners can expect an organized approach to bring back the performance of their French doors. The repair procedure usually includes:

  1. Assessment: A specialist takes a look at the doors for alignment, glass condition, and frame integrity.
  2. Evaluation: The service technician goes over the homeowner's issues and recommends the essential repairs.
  3. Repairs: Actions may include straightening doors, changing hinges, sealing weather removing, or replacing broken glass.
  4. Follow-Up: It is vital to ensure that the repairs are acceptable which the doors operate properly after repair.

6. FAQs about French Door Repair

Q1: How frequently need to French doors be maintained?A1: Regular maintenance is necessary. Property owners need to inspect their doors a minimum of two times a year for any signs of damage or wear. Q2: Can I paint or stain my French doors?A2: Yes, however it's best to use weather-resistant items. Ensure to prepare the surface area appropriately to make sure longevity. Q3: How long does a typical repair take?A3: The duration of repairs varies based on the problem's complexity, but many repairs can

be completed within a couple of hours. Q4: Is it worth repairing old French doors?A4: If the doors are structurally sound and the repairs are reasonable, it can be worthwhile to restore them rather

than change them. Q5: What ought to I do if my
glass is fogged up?A5: Fogging indicates a failure in the seal; replacement of the glass panes is typically necessary to restore visibility and performance.
